Erionite

Although asbestos lawyer is the most frequent mesothelioma cause, it's not the only mineral that has been linked to the cancer. In some instances other substances, such as erionite (a kind of zeolite) has also been associated with the disease. Erionite, like asbestos can cause mesothelioma if it is inhaled or eaten.

In the 1970s, a remarkablely mesothelioma-related rate was observed in a variety of villages in Turkey in which erionite-bearing rocks are found. In these villages, pleural mesothelioma could be responsible for up to 50% of deaths in a few households.

A team comprised of environmental scientists, geologists and mesothelioma specialists as well as surgeons and physicians worked together to find out the reason for this rare lung cancer. They discovered that a few families from the Turkish village had a gene mutation which made them susceptible to mesothelioma that was caused by Erionite. The mutations were passed down from generation to generation. Other factors, like smoking cigarettes or exposure to other asbestos-related substances, can also increase the risk of a person developing mesothelioma.

The mesothelioma triggered by erionite is most likely caused by long-term, heavy inhalation of the gravel dust containing the material. It was prevalent in rural areas where mining and road construction occurred. In Dunn County, North Dakota, erionite exposure has been associated with mesothelioma and various respiratory diseases.
